乐趣区

关于java:Spring-Boot-的2020最后一击2412372212-发布

近日,Spring Boot 官网公布了本年度最初一次版本更新,次要针对目前保护的三个版本:

  • 2.4.x:第一个 bug 修复版本 2.4.1
  • 2.3.x:惯例保护版本 2.3.7
  • 2.2.x:惯例保护版本 2.2.12

因为 2.2.x 和 2.3.x 曾经十分稳固,所以咱们次要关注本次 2.4.1 的更新。

2.4.1 版本内容

因为在 Spring Boot 2.4.0 版本中,对原有的配置加载机制做了较大改变,不少开发者反映在降级的时候也呈现了各种不同的问题。而这次 2.4.1 的公布,次要着手解决了不少对于配置相干的 Bug。上面咱们一起看看这次都解决了哪些重要问题:

  1. 通过通配符匹配的配置文件相互笼罩的问题
  2. 配置属性与 JavaBean 之间绑定的程序问题
  3. 容许递归配置文件组的援用
  4. 内部应用程序属性加载程序的问题
  5. @Name 在 Kotlin 中绑定失败的问题
  6. Redis 健康检查器对性能耗费过大的问题
  7. Actuator 端点在 MVC 和 WebFlux 下运行时,无奈正确响应自定义 HTTP 状态码
  8. Actuator 的 env 端点没有正确显示包装类型的数据
  9. 通过配置树绑定非字符串属性时,找不到转换器的问题
  10. 应用 Log4J 调用 LoggingSystem 时会抛出 NullPointerException 的问题
  11. 加载属性文件的时候,“#”标注之后的内容会失落
  12. 在启用 WebTestClientContextCustomizer 之前,确保 WebClient 曾经存在

能够看到,大量的修复都是针对配置相干的。那么读者在之前的降级过程中,是否有碰到上述问题吗?

这次的更新是否能够解决呢?欢送留言说说你对 2.4.0 版本的认识吧!

  • 更多对于本版本的公布内容和相干 Issue 可通过本链接查看:https://github.com/spring-pro…
  • Spring Boot 收费教程举荐:http://blog.didispace.com/spr…

欢送关注我的公众号:程序猿 DD,取得独家整顿的收费学习资源助力你的 Java 学习之路!另每周赠书不停哦~

退出移动版